Is it possible to make IMCE something like Google Sites editor?

When a poster wants to attach an image to his post, he only wants to
upload an image and then attach it to his post. He does not care about
the images uploaded previously to the server. So the image attachment
process should be very simple:
1) user click a Image button 2
2) user click Browse button to select an image file on his local computer
3) user click Upload button to upload image file to server
4) user click Attach button to attach image to his post
And that's it.
The uploader program should rename the image filename if there is duplicate
on the server -- so that it will not overwrite the existing namesake file.
Maybe all files should be renamed by appending a timestamp to their filenames.
Also, by default, the attached image should be made a hyperlink which will
open the image file in a new window.
